Output 43df66b93091ae226093caf72bb46d6c4be01bc591cd1ff990e30e4e662febb4:1

value
914184
script pubkey
OP_0 OP_PUSHBYTES_20 021d52d020b85a4bf2546b6246e2b9788b7c5884
address
ltc1qqgw495pqhpdyhuj5dd3ydc4e0z9hckyylxskfq
transaction
43df66b93091ae226093caf72bb46d6c4be01bc591cd1ff990e30e4e662febb4
spent
true